The sum of two natural numbers is 17,402. One of the two numbers is divisible by 10. If the units digit of that number is erased, the other number is obtained. What is the difference of these two numbers? (A)10,272(B)11,700(C)13,362(D)14,238(E)15,426
Official solution
The units digit of a multiple of 10 will always be 0. We add a 0 whenever we multiply by 10. So, removing the units digit is equal to dividing by 10. Let the smaller number (the one we get after removing the units digit) be a. This means the bigger number would be 10a. We know the sum is 10a+a=11a so 11a=17402. So a=1582. The difference is 10a−a=9a. So, the answer is 9(1582)=(D)14,238. ~abhinavg0627
